How To Choose The Best Milk Supply Supplement
Not all lactation supplements work the same way. Some use fenugreek to stimulate prolactin, others use moringa as a gentler galactagogue, and a few focus on choline to support the nutrient profile of your milk. The key is matching the active ingredient to your body’s tolerance and your baby’s reaction.
Identify the Active Galactagogue
Fenugreek is the most common herb for boosting supply, but it can cause a maple-syrup body odor and may not suit mothers with thyroid conditions. Moringa is a fenugreek alternative that works well for sensitive babies, though dosing requirements are higher. Choline (specifically as choline chloride) supports the fat metabolism that transfers DHA into breast milk, improving quality alongside quantity.

Evaluate Serving Size and Cost Per Dose
A bottle with 30 servings at the premium end can still be more economical than a cheap bottle if it requires only 2 capsules a day versus 6. Calculate the daily cost hidden in the label: value isn’t about the price tag on the bottle, but how many effective doses you actually get.
